As Netflix embarks on the second season of One Piece, the Straw Hat crew is poised to expand, and a pivotal addition has been unveiled: Tony Tony Chopper, the crew’s diminutive doctor. This eagerly anticipated introduction was showcased during the Tudum livestream event, featuring One Piece stars Iñaki Godoy, Mackenyu, Emily Rudd, Jacob Romero, and Taz Skylar, who presented a sneak peek at the upcoming season, including the first look at the live-action series’ interpretation of Chopper.
The sneak peek, revealed below, offers a glimpse into the character’s introduction in the live-action adaptation.
Mikaela Hoover, known for her role in Guardians of the Galaxy Volume 3, will portray Chopper, providing both voice work and facial motion capture for the character. Chopper’s backstory, as an aspiring medic who gained human-reindeer hybrid form after consuming a devil fruit, will likely be an intriguing aspect of his introduction in the series. His desire to travel and expand his medical knowledge drives his narrative, making him a compelling addition to the Straw Hat crew.
Although Netflix has not disclosed a specific release date for the second season, beyond confirming it will premiere next year, the addition of Chopper, played by Hoover, is part of a larger cast expansion. Other new faces joining the series include Katey Sagal, Joe Manganiello, David Dastmalchian, Clive Russell, and James Hiroyuki Lio, among others.
